Thailand in shock — UK blacklists 4 Thai firms for allegedly supporting Russia’s war in Ukraine
The United Kingdom has placed four companies from Thailand on its sanctions list for allegedly supporting Russia in its ongoing war against Ukraine. This move has created concern in Thailand, especially since it may affect the country’s reputation and its trade with Western nations.

About 10,000 North Korean troops deployed on Russia-Ukraine border – South Korean intelligence
Around 10,000 North Korean troops have been deployed near the border between Russia and Ukraine. Source: South Korean MP Lee Seong-kwon, citing data from the country's National Intelligence Service NIS ,
